Transaction 6b70e759e6972ef93a4c4587606556832801f3699ccdd1aa42f4dc0ba430b03c
1 Input
1 Output
-
6b70e759e6972ef93a4c4587606556832801f3699ccdd1aa42f4dc0ba430b03c:0
- value
- 643404
- script pubkey
- OP_0 OP_PUSHBYTES_20 755a9c7f21ad68acb61f52b3e0e59a37319cbfa8
- address
- bc1qw4dfclep4452edsl22e7pev6xucee0ag579pd6